Laura helps Mei prepare for her geography presentation on Thailand by providing key details about the country. Laura informs Mei that the capital of Thailand is Bangkok, Thailand joined ASEAN in 1967, the official language is Thai, the population is 67 million, and the total area is around 510,000 square kilometers. Mei learns from Laura that Thai food is known for being spicy and tourists enjoy trying different street foods. Laura also mentions several Thai festivals and holidays including Farmers' Day and Vegetarian's Day as well as New Years Day and Chinese New Year. Laura recommends popular tourist destinations in Thailand such as Sukhothai City, Grand Palace, and Koh Phi Phi islands.
